[Bug 1462489] Re: Allow apps to keep the screen on
We have a patch for QScreenSaver. The way it will work is that apps can
use this from QML:
import QtSystemInfo 5.0
ScreenSaver { screenSaverEnabled: false }
or its pendant from C++. Unity-System-Compositor will watch the
application. As soon as the application is closed, the request will be
dropped and the screensaver will be enabled again, even if the app
didn't explicitly release the resource before quitting.
We need apparmor to allow apps to call the methods:
* keepDisplayOn
* removeDisplayOnRequest
on interface:
com.canonical.Unity.Screen
and path:
/com/canonical/Unity/Screen
on the *system* bus.

Bug description:
Support an interface in QML and HTML to allow an app to keep the
screen on while the app is active. This has come up in several
scenarios, such as an ebook reader, a clock in night mode.
First step is to hook up QtSystemInfo screenSaverEnabled
One solution to inhibit the screen blanking:
Add a new dbus rule to the default template
Provide a mediator (unity8) to control this, so it can restore the screen blanking when the app is not active or has been closed
Prompt the user for confirmation the first time the app accesses it
use the trust store to avoid prompts each time
add to the System settings Other app access panel an entry for Screen or Display so the setting could be revoked
